Legal Shield Empowers WordPress Theme Designers
I worked with a niche WordPress development agency that launched a library of custom-designed themes for small business websites. The designs were original, tailored for specific industries like local salons, fitness studios, and real estate firms. Early on, the agency found several of its themes copied and redistributed on third-party sites without permission. This not only undercut their business but also discouraged their in-house designers who felt their creative input was being exploited.
Instead of giving up, the agency took legal steps under copyright law. They filed DMCA takedowns and publicly reaffirmed their copyright ownership. Over time, enforcement built credibility and a sense of security. The designers regained confidence, knowing their work had legal protection. As a result, the team felt more empowered to experiment--leading to the launch of a new series of interactive themes, which became a significant revenue driver and attracted long-term clients.
The experience reinforced how copyright isn't just a legal shield--it's a creative enabler. When creators know their work is protected, they're more willing to invest time, effort, and originality into what they do.

Copyright Safeguards Independent Artist's Success
I once witnessed the positive impact of copyright law in the music industry, where an independent artist was able to protect their work and retain full creative control. This artist released a song that quickly gained popularity, but with its success came numerous unauthorized uses of their music on various platforms. Thanks to copyright protection, the artist was able to take legal action against these infringements, ensuring that their work was properly credited and compensated.
This experience showed me how copyright law fosters creativity by giving creators the assurance that their ideas will be protected and they will benefit from their hard work. The artist was able to reinvest in their music career, producing even more original content, and the recognition they received for their work helped inspire others. Copyright protection not only ensured that the artist received fair compensation but also enabled them to continue innovating and contributing to the creative ecosystem.
